Event to share the long and short -- and stout -- of tea

There is oh-so-much more to tea than simply dunking a bag in a mug of hot water. "Discover Tea and Tea Tasting," to be hosted by the Voorheesville Public Library, will expand on that.

The event, scheduled for 7 to 8 p.m. Wednesday, March 8, will feature a "tea ambassador" from the Short and Stout Tea Company for a discussion on what tea is, its history, and how it is brewed. And, of course, there will be tea tasting.

As the event organizers ask, "Did you know that white, green, oolong and black tea all come from the same tea plant? Find out what happens after the leaves are plucked that makes all the difference."
